Robert Hoogs, born March 23, 1933 in Honolulu, HI, died October 9, 2015 in Cottonwood, AZ.
As one of Jehovah's Witnesses, he spent many happy years in the Christian Ministry along with his wife Suzanne. They were married in Honolulu in 1958.
He worked at Argonne National Lab's Idaho Facility for 30 years in the Nuclear Power test reactor there, then retired to Arizona in 1989.
He lived in Mesa, Tucson, and finally Cottonwood. Survivors include wife, Suzanne, sons Russell Hoogs of Idaho Falls, ID, Randy Hoogs of Sedona, daughter Holly Hoogs of Cornville, 13 grandchildren and 11 great grandchildren.
A Memorial Service will be held Saturday, Oct. 17 at the Kingdom Hall of Jehovah's Witnesses in Cottonwood at 2 p.m., followed by a gathering of friends and family at the 'On The Greens' social hall.
